Digital marketing: It consists in the exploitation of digital media, such as specific web pages, social networks and emails, to communicate with a selected target market. It is a new and emerging line of efforts through which a business can get new potential audiences. A few of the most common tactics employed in digital marketing include:
Search engine optimization (SEO):
It involves improving the strategies applied on the business website in order to achieve higher rankings in search engine result pages (SERPs). SEO is a complicated process that involves many steps and understanding how search engines work and what the best practices are.
Pay-per-click (PPC) results display, those ads that a company pays for, that are placed on the pages of search engines and on different websites: PPC is related to advertisements that help increase sales or capture prospects but the drawback is it can be a costly affair.

Comparison of Different Marketing Channels
Channel | Advantages | Disadvantages |
Social media marketing | Wide reach, cost-effective, engagement opportunities | Algorithm changes, competition, time-consuming |
Content marketing | Builds trust, attracts organic traffic | Time-consuming, requires expertise |
SEO | Generates organic traffic, long-term results | Competitive, takes time to see results |
PPC advertising | Targeted reach, fast results | Can be expensive, requires ongoing management |
Email marketing | High ROI, personalized communication | Can be spammy, requires email list building |
